首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
linjinhe
掘友等级
coredump
|
。
擅长C++、分布式、数据库
关注
私信
获得徽章 0
动态
文章
专栏
沸点
收藏集
1
关注
赞
26
文章 24
沸点 2
资讯 0
赞
26
关注
返回
|
搜索文章
linjinhe
coredump @ 。
·
2年前
关注
DuckDB:开篇
简单说,DuckDB 是一个 C++ 编写的 OLAP(列存)版本的 SQLite。 麻雀虽小,五脏俱全。...
3
评论
分享
linjinhe
coredump @ 。
·
2年前
关注
FoundationDB:Apple 开源的分布式 KV 存储
FoundationDB(简称 FDB),是 Apple 公司开源的一个支持分布式事务的 Key-Value 存储,可以认为类似 PingCAP 开源的 TiKV。...
2
评论
分享
linjinhe
赞了这篇沸点
linjinhe
coredump @ 。
·
2年前
举报
#备忘#
π 秒是十亿分之一世纪。
赞过
分享
评论
1
linjinhe
coredump @ 。
·
2年前
关注
Linux 文件 I/O 进化史(四):io_uring —— 全新的异步 I/O
io_uring 是 2019 年 5 月发布的 Linux 5.1 加入的一个重大特性 —— Linux 下的全新的异步 I/O 支持,希望能彻底解决长期以来 Linux...
3
1
分享
linjinhe
coredump @ 。
·
2年前
关注
Linux 文件 I/O 进化史(三):Direct I/O 和 Linux AIO
前面介绍的 buffered I/O 和 mmap,访问文件都是需要经过内核的 page cache。这对于数据库这种 self-caching 的应用可能不是特别友好: ...
3
评论
分享
linjinhe
coredump @ 。
·
2年前
关注
Linux 文件 I/O 进化史(二):mmap
mmap 可以将文件或设备映射到内存中,使应用程序可以像读写内存一样读写文件。 具体参数说明可以参考 Linux Programmer's Manual: mmap(2)。...
2
评论
分享
linjinhe
coredump @ 。
·
2年前
关注
Linux 文件 I/O 进化史(一):Buffered I/O
想找时间复习和总结一下 Linux 的文件 I/O 方式。大概想了,主要内容可以分成 4 个部分: Buffered I/O:传统的基于 page cache 的文件读写。...
1
1
分享
linjinhe
赞了这篇文章
linjinhe
coredump @ 。
·
2年前
关注
LevelDB 完全解析(11):Compaction
清理过期(旧版本或者已删除)的数据。 维护数据的有序性。 当 MemTable 的大小达到阈值时,进行 MemTable 切换,然后需要将 Immutable MemTab...
1
评论
分享
linjinhe
赞了这篇文章
linjinhe
coredump @ 。
·
2年前
关注
现代 C++:一文读懂智能指针
std::unique_ptr<T> :独占资源所有权的指针。 std::shared_ptr<T> :共享资源所有权的指针。 std::weak_ptr<T> :共享资源...
6
2
分享
linjinhe
coredump @ 。
·
2年前
关注
[小长文]Linux 内存管理
在 Linux 下,每个进程都拥有独立的虚拟地址空间。 在 IA-32 的场景下,虚拟地址只有 32 位,所以最大的寻址空间是 2^32 = 4GB。Linux 内核将这个...
8
评论
分享
linjinhe
coredump @ 。
·
2年前
举报
计算机领域的“5 分钟法则(Five-minute rule)”
en.wikipedia.org
赞过
分享
评论
1
linjinhe
赞了这篇文章
linjinhe
coredump @ 。
·
3年前
关注
现代 C++:自动类型推导
现代的编程语言,不管是动态语言(JavaScript、Python 等),还是静态语言(Go、Rust 等),大都支持自动类型推导(type deduction)。 自动类...
1
评论
分享
linjinhe
coredump @ 。
·
3年前
关注
LevelDB 完全解析(7):初始化
从 Manifest 文件恢复各个 level 的 SSTable 的元数据。 根据 log 文件恢复 MemTable。 恢复 last_sequence_、next_f...
1
1
分享
linjinhe
赞了这篇文章
linjinhe
coredump @ 。
·
3年前
关注
LevelDB 完全解析(0):基本原理和整体架构
之前零零散散写过几篇和 LSM-Tree、LevelDB 有关的文章。之后也看了一些代码和论文,笔记也做了一些,但大都比较零乱、随意,没花功夫整理。 这次打算将之前的文章和...
5
评论
分享
linjinhe
关注了标签
Linux
coredump @ 。
linjinhe
关注了标签
数据库
coredump @ 。
linjinhe
关注了标签
面试
coredump @ 。
linjinhe
关注了标签
算法
coredump @ 。
linjinhe
关注了标签
Go
coredump @ 。
linjinhe
关注了标签
Redis
coredump @ 。
下一页
个人成就
文章被点赞
54
文章被阅读
32,970
掘力值
897
关注了
0
关注者
31
收藏集
1
关注标签
9
加入于
2020-02-12